Experience

Most of my tutoring experience is from the University of North Texas. I volunteered as a math tutor during my freshmen year and was then a supplemental instruction leader for an elementary statistics class during my sophomore year. By my last year at UNT, I became a teaching assistant, grader, and worked at the school math lab. As a teaching assistant, I was able to prepare and present lessons for students to have a better understanding of course content. As a grader, I worked with professors to give feedback on student assignments. As a tutor in the math lab, I worked with students individually and at a pace they were comfortable with. Outside of UNT, I also tutored students from 7th grade to 11th grade for about one to two years.
